Among the special places to discover in this country, there is the famous Yungas road. This route over 60 km connects the city of La Paz to the village of Coroico. It is nicknamed the "Camino de la Muerte" because of the many who died there. On this track, lovers thrill can embark on a bike raid terrain. This activity will allow them to enjoy the beautiful landscapes of this part of the Andes. It will also give them the chance to ride on one of the most dangerous lines of communication on the planet.

To storm the Salar de Uyuni in all-terrain vehicle is a must during a Bolivia circuitry. This huge salt desert with an area of 10 582 km² is the largest in the world. It is located in the southwest of the country. This salt has a plain view breathtaking often giving holidaymakers the urge to take unusual photos. In this site, travelers can visit the IsladelPescado. This small hill is covered with cactus candelabra some of which are aged about 1 000 years. She temporarily transformed into island during the rainy season. The backpackers also have the opportunity to relax in the hot springs of this haven. These waters have a beneficial property Health. Going on safari in Madidi National Park

Madidi National Park is a place not to be missed during a trip to Bolivia. This protected area 18 957 km² is located in the department of La Paz. It is reputed to be one of the most important nature reserves for biodiversity. This wildlife sanctuary is a paradise for fans of photo safari. Indeed, this part of the Amazon jungle is a refuge for various species of animals. In this haven, Adventurers can admire Guyana sapajous, des aras de Lafresnaye, good des ou encore des piranhas. Tourists will also have the chance to meet indigenous tribes that inhabit this forest.

Make a trip to Potosi

Visit the city of Potosi is inevitable during a trip to Bolivia. With its 4 070 m d’altitude, this municipality is one of the highest cities in the world. It is listed on the list of World Heritage in Danger UNESCO. In this locality, backpackers can visit the famous Cerro Rico. This mountain 4 782 m was exploited by the conquistadors for his valuable silver ores. It is home to many active mines that adventurers can explore with a guide. This will give globetrotters the opportunity to know a little more about the lifestyle of the miners of Potosi.
